THE HERTFORDSHIRE GOLF CLUB, BROXBOURNE – Essex under 14s were beaten 10-5 after they came up against formidable opponents on Thursday May 28.
The away team performed well in the morning, securing a 3-2 lead in the foursomes against Herts.
Among the strongest performers were the talented Boyce Hill duo of David Biffault and Cody Strachan who won two up.
But it was all change in the afternoon singles as the home side romped home 8-2 for a final score of 10-5.
Under 14s team manager, Keith Mitchell, praised his young team. He said: “Some of the Hertfordshire team boasted very low handicaps and the Essex lads realised that they were up against some formidable opponents.”
Nick Ward playing off scratch saw off Spencer Adams Dunstan (8) with an impressive 4 under par with six holes to play.
Billy Mason gained a very good half against William Aldred with a chip in at the 162 yard 13 to turn the match. Jason Horne fought hard against Joe Brooks to lose 2 down but Jack Marshall gained Essex a solitary afternoon win against Bradley Henwood.
From this point on a procession of victories by Hertfordshire with a solitary half from Michael Kendrick rounded off an emphatic win of 10-5 to Hertfordshire. Having said this many of the matches went to the last hole but the rather late fight backs could not dislodge the Hertfordshire boys from a deserved victory.
Mr Mitchell added: “The Hertfordshire club were really excellent hosts providing a memorable occasion for the boys in their first match of the year. The course was a fine test of golf for boys who play at a really high standard and the Hertfordshire staff and club members made us very welcome.”
The Essex boys taking part were: Spencer Adams Dunstan (Langdon Hills), Billy Mason (Maldon), Jason Horne (Orsett), Charlie Sargeant (Stoke by Nayland), Cody Strachan (Boyce Hill), David Briffault (Boyce Hill), Jack Marshall (Crowlands Heath), Bobby Keeble (Woolston Manor), Mitchell Sarling(Boyce Hill), Michael Kendrick (Forrester Park).
